Navidea to Report Manocept™ Results in Kaposi’s Sarcoma at the International Workshop on KSHV and Related Agents

On June 4, 2015 Navidea Biopharmaceuticals reported that four presentations of Manocept data from Kaposi’s Sarcoma (KS) studies are scheduled at the 18th International Workshop on Kaposi’s Sarcoma Herpesvirus (KSHV) and Related Agents in Hollywood, Florida from June 30 – July 3, 2015 (Press release, Navidea Biopharmaceuticals, JUN 4, 2015, View Source;p=RssLanding&cat=news&id=2056585 [SID:1234505429]). This research highlights a very likely new approach to the origin of KS supported by preclinical and clinical imaging studies. In addition, data will be presented demonstrating the therapeutic potential for Manocept therapeutic conjugates. MT1001 is a proprietary agent designed to target cells expressing the mannose receptor (CD206) and destroy the cell and its contents. Data will be presented demonstrating MT1001’s ability to target KS and KS tumor-associated macrophages by selectively binding to CD206. Details of the presentations are listed below.

OPKO Health to Acquire Bio-Reference Laboratories

On June 4, 2015 OPKO HEALTH, INC. (NYSE:OPK) and Bio-Reference Laboratories, Inc. (NASDAQ:BRLI) reported that the companies have signed a definitive merger agreement under which OPKO will acquire Bio-Reference Laboratories (Press release, Opko Health, JUN 4, 2015, View Source [SID:1234506549]). Bio-Reference Laboratories is the third largest full service clinical laboratory in the United States and is known for its innovative technological solutions and pioneering leadership in the areas of genomics and genetic sequencing. Under the terms of the agreement, which has been approved by the Boards of Directors of both companies, holders of BRLI common stock will receive 2.75 shares of OPKO common stock for each share of BRLI common stock. Based on a closing price of $19.12 per share of OPKO common stock on June 3, 2015, the transaction is valued at approximately $1.47 billion, or $52.58 per share of BRLI common stock. The Companies expect the transaction to be completed during the second half of 2015. Closing of the transaction is subject to approval of Bio-Reference Laboratories’ shareholders and other customary conditions.

OPKO intends to leverage the national marketing, sales, and distribution resources of Bio-Reference Laboratories to enhance sales of its 4Kscore test, a blood test that provides a patient’s specific personalized risk score for aggressive prostate cancer as well as other OPKO diagnostic products under development.

Through GeneDx, Bio-Reference Laboratories’ genetic sequencing laboratory, and GenPath Diagnostics, its Oncology and Women’s Health business units, Bio-Reference Laboratories has accumulated a vast array of genetic and genomics data that OPKO will make available to industry and academic scientists to enhance their drug discovery and clinical trial programs.

Novel Data On PV-10 For Melanoma Treatment Presented At ASCO

On June 4, 2014 Provectus Pharmaceuticals reported new findings on PV-10, an investigational intra-lesional therapy for melanoma, were presented during the American Society of Clinical Oncology (ASCO) (Free ASCO Whitepaper)’s Annual Meeting on May 31, 2015, Chicago, Illinois, USA (Press release, Provectus Pharmaceuticals, JUN 4, 2015, View Source [SID:1234505231]). The presentation entitled "A Changing Topography: The Role of Intralesional Therapy in Melanoma" was presented by Dr. Sanjiv Agarwala, from St. Luke’s Cancer Center in Bethlehem and Temple University School of Medicine in Pennsylvania, USA.

Melanoma is a cancer that has its origins in melanocytes, cells that produce the brown pigment called melanin which protects the deeper layers of the skin from the harmful effects of the sun. Melanoma is much less frequent than basal cell and squamous cell skin cancers, but it is far more dangerous. Like basal cell and squamous cell cancers, melanoma is almost always curable if detected earlier but has a higher probability to spread to other parts of the body if it is not detected early.

PV-10 is Provectus Biopharmaceuticals’ new experimental drug for cancer, and was designed to be injected into solid tumors i.e. intralesional administration, to reduce potential systemic adverse effects. The FDA has already granted an orphan drug designation for Provectus’ melanoma and hepatocellular carcinoma indications.

Dr. Sanjiv Agarwala established as mains goals of intra-lesional therapy local disease control (decreasing tumor size during a prolonged period), control of symptoms and palliation, decreased systemic effect (immune mediated), delay or prevention of systemic treatment and neo-adjuvant potential. The researcher showed results from the phase 3 trial from T-VEC, an HSV-1-derived oncolytic immunotherapy conceived to induce local and systemic effects. He also showed phase 2 findings for PV-10, showing the drug accumulated within cancer cells but not normal cells, inducing acute autophagy and exposing antigenic tumor fragments to antigenic presenting cells (APCs).

Dr. Agarwala stated that intralesional approaches may hold a promising value, since they act locally and do not have a systemic immune effect. Moreover the researcher concluded that combination therapies are probably the future of melanoma treatment and may be the best way to transition into clinical practice.

Celgene Announces New Data to be Presented at European League Against Rheumatism Annual Congress

On June 3, 2015 Celgene International Sàrl, a wholly-owned subsidiary of Celgene Corporation (NASDAQ:CELG), reported that data from 11 abstracts (two oral presentations, six poster presentations and three published in The Abstract Book) evaluating Celgene investigational and marketed products will be presented at the European League Against Rheumatism (EULAR) Annual Congress in Rome, Italy, June 10 – 13, 2015 (Press release, Celgene, JUN 3, 2015, View Source [SID:1234512521]). The data will include the latest research findings on Otezla (apremilast), the Company’s oral, selective inhibitor of phosphodiesterase 4 (PDE4), in psoriatic arthritis and plaque psoriasis, as well as CC-220, an investigational immunomodulatory compound for systemic lupus erythematosus (lupus).

Among the data presented will be long-term (104-week) results from Celgene’s PALACE program, including pooled results of three phase III trials (PALACE 1, 2 and 3) assessing the effects of OTEZLA on two distinct manifestations of psoriatic arthritis – enthesitis (inflammation at sites where tendons or ligaments insert into bone) and dactylitis (inflammation of an entire digit). Additional analyses of PALACE trials will evaluate long-term safety and efficacy of OTEZLA in patients with active psoriatic arthritis, as well as the impact of OTEZLA on work productivity and physical function in these patients.

Data will also be presented on the effect of CC-220 on blood cell levels of Ikaros and Aiolos – transcription factors that, when mutated, are associated with an increased risk of systemic lupus erythematosus. The presentation will include phase I data on the impact of CC-220 on the immune response in healthy volunteers. Additional preclinical studies on CC-220 in lupus will be presented.
